Konica Minolta introduces new DT series lenses - As the new standard for digital SLR cameras, DT lenses are ideally suited to digital SLR cameras such as the Dynax7D and Dynax 5D that are equipped with APS-C sized(23.5 x 15.7 mm) CCDs.

Konica Minolta AF DT Zoom 18 -70 mm F3.5 to 5.6 (D)
Konica Minolta AF DT Zoom 11-18 mm F4.5 to 5.6 (D)
Konica Minolta AF DT Zoom 18-200 mm F3.5 to 6.3 (D)
Key features:
1. Optimum high-performance optical design for digital SLR cameras
To ensure consistently high quality images, the Dynax5D uses an optical systemideally suited to a APS-C sized (23.5 x 15.7 mm) CCD, in addition to spherical lensesto reduce spherical aberrations, AD (anomalous dispersion) glass, and a special lenscoating that reduces flare that can occur in digital SLR cameras.
2. Effective Anti-Shake compensation equivalent to a shutter speed 2 3 stopsslower*1 with Dynax digital SLR camera
3. Distance encoder enables precise ADI flash metering
Using information obtained from the lens built-in distance encoder, AdvancedDistance Integration (ADI) flash metering calculates the optimum exposure settings andflash brightness needed to obtain a beautiful image when using either the internal flashor external flash units such as the Program Flash 5600HS(D) or 3600HS(D), and2500(D).
4. Circular aperture beautifully enhances defocused images
A round aperture makes it possible to enhance a defocused image with smoothgradations and depict a scene naturally, for example, sunshine filtering through foliageor grass glistening with morning dew.
Note: Dynax DT series lenses are not compatible with conventional 35mm SLR cameras
Konica Minolta AF DT ZOOM 18-70mm F3.5-5.6 (D)
Focal length*: 18-70mm
Angle of view: 76 (18mm) - 23 (70mm)
Aperture: Maximum: f/3.5(18mm) 5.6 (70mm) Minimum: f/22(18mm)-36(70mm)
Blades: 7-blade circular
Optics: Construction: 11 elements in 9 groups Includes one AD (anomalous dispersion) glass elements and one Aspheric element.
Focusing: AF motor: Camera body (coupler)
Method: Front focusing
Minimum focus distance: 0.38m
Maximum magnification: 1/4
Filter diameter: 55mm
Lens hood: Petal-type hood with bayonet mount
Dimensions: 66 (dia.) x 77 (length) mm
Weight: 240g
Lens mount: Minolta A mount
Standard accessories: Front cap, Rear cap, Lens hood
Optional accessory: Soft case
Konica Minolta AF DT ZOOM 11-18mm F4.5-5.6 (D)
Focal length*: 11-18mm
Angle of view: 104 (11mm) - 76 (18mm)
Aperture: Maximum: f/4.5(11mm) 5.6(18mm) Minimum: f/22(11mm)-29(18mm)
Blades: 7-blade circular
Optics: Construction: 15 elements in 12 groups Includes one AD (anomalous dispersion) glass elements and three Aspheric elements.
Focusing: AF motor: Camera body (coupler)
Method: Internal focusing Minimum focus distance: 0.25m
Maximum magnification: 1/8
Filter diameter: 77mm
Lens hood: Petal-type hood with bayonet mount
Dimensions: 83 (dia.) x 80.5 (length) mm
Weight: 350g
Lens mount: Minolta A mount
Standard accessories: Front cap, Rear cap, Lens hood
Optional accessory: Soft case
Konica Minolta AF DT ZOOM 18-200mm F3.5-6.3 (D)
Focal length*: 18-200mm Angle of view: 76 (18mm) - 8 (200mm)
Aperture: Maximum: f/3.5(18mm) 6.3(200mm) Minimum: f/22(18mm)-40(200mm)
Blades: 7-blade circular
Optics: Construction: 15 elements in 13 groups Includes two AD (anomalous dispersion) glass elements and three Aspheric elements.
Focusing: AF motor: Camera body (coupler)
Method: Internal focusing
Minimum focus distance: 0.45m
Maximum magnification: 1/3.71
Filter diameter: 62mm
Lens hood: Petal-type hood with bayonet mount
Dimensions: 73 (dia.) x 85.65 (length) mm
Weight: 407g
Lens mount: Minolta A mount
Standard accessories: Front cap, Rear cap, Lens hood
Optional accessory: Soft case
*:Lens focal lengths indicates the focal length obtained when he lens is mounted on a 35mm SLR body. When mounted on the Dynax 7D and Dynax 5D, the actual focal length will be approximately 1.5x longer than the stated focal length.
*AF DT lens series are not compatible with conventional 35mm SLR cameras.

Price and availability
| Model | Price | Availability |
| 18 -70 mm F3.5 to 5.6 (D) | 110 | September 2005 |
| 11-18 mm F4.5 to 5.6 (D) | 449 | September 2005 |
| 18-200 mm F3.5 to 6.3 (D) | 380 | November 2005 |
